2025-26 School Year
Location:
Davis Middle
4.0 scheduled hours per day; 9:30 a.m. to 2 p.m.;
Work August through May when students are in session
Reports To:
Executive Director of Nutrition Services
Primary responsibilities include the safe operation of the dish machine. Assists with the preparation and serving of quality meals to students and staff, cleaning and sanitation of equipment, rotating food stock and supplies, and providing superior customer service.

- Performs repetitive activities for prolonged periods of time.
- Knowledge of the variety of cleaning supplies.
- Maintains clean and safe area around the dish machine.
- Monitors dish machine temperature and soap dispensing equipment for accuracy.
- Disassembles and cleans dish machine daily, and performs weekly deliming.
